GitHub Enterprise Server 310 Docs представляет собой мощный инструмент для управления доступом к программным продуктам в организации. Созданный GitHub, он предлагает широкий спектр функций и возможностей, которые позволяют эффективно и безопасно работать с проектами разных размеров и сложности.
Одной из ключевых особенностей GitHub Enterprise Server 310 Docs является встроенная система управления доступом, которая позволяет администраторам полностью контролировать, кто имеет право на доступ к различным репозиториям и функциям на платформе. Это особенно полезно в организациях, где необходимо обеспечить безопасность и контроль доступа к конфиденциальной информации и интеллектуальной собственности.
С помощью GitHub Enterprise Server 310 Docs администраторы могут создавать команды и управлять их составом, назначать различные роли сотрудникам и устанавливать права доступа на уровне команды и отдельного пользователя. Это позволяет гибко настраивать доступ и контролировать процессы разработки программного обеспечения в организации.
GitHub Enterprise Server 310 Docs представляет собой мощное средство для управления доступом к программным продуктам в организации. С его помощью вы можете эффективно контролировать доступ к репозиториям и функциям на платформе, обеспечивая безопасность и конфиденциальность ваших проектов. Также вы можете гибко настраивать доступ различным командам и пользователям, устанавливая различные роли и права доступа. Все это делает GitHub Enterprise Server 310 Docs идеальным выбором для организаций, которые ищут надежный и удобный инструмент для управления доступом к программным продуктам.
- Раздел 1: Настройка ролей и разрешений
- Настройка ограничений доступа
- Назначение ролей пользователям
- Установка разрешений для ролей
- Раздел 2: Управление группами пользователей
- Создание и управление группами
- Присвоение прав доступа группам
- Добавление и удаление пользователей из группы
- Вопрос-ответ:
- Что такое GitHub Enterprise Server 310 Docs?
- Каким образом GitHub Enterprise Server помогает в управлении доступом к программным продуктам?
- Как можно установить GitHub Enterprise Server для управления доступом?
- Какие существуют роли и разрешения в GitHub Enterprise Server?
- Как осуществляется аудит изменений в GitHub Enterprise Server?
- Что такое GitHub Enterprise Server 310 Docs?
- Какие функции предоставляет GitHub Enterprise Server 310 Docs?
- Видео:
- Git – как совместно вести разработку одного проекта. Полезно знать новичкам в программировании.
Раздел 1: Настройка ролей и разрешений
Для эффективного управления доступом к программным продуктам в организации с помощью GitHub Enterprise Server 310 Docs, необходимо настроить роли и разрешения для пользователей и команд.
Роли определяют уровень доступа к репозиториям и организациям в GitHub. Существуют несколько предопределенных ролей, таких как владелец, администратор, сотрудник и наблюдатель. Каждая роль имеет свои особенности и возможности, и может быть назначена как для отдельных пользователей, так и для команд.
Разрешения определяют, какие действия может выполнять пользователь или команда в рамках роли. Например, права на чтение, запись, создание веток и запросы на слияние. Настройка разрешений позволяет гибко управлять доступом к коду и другим ресурсам, чтобы поддерживать безопасность и эффективность работы.
Для настройки ролей и разрешений в GitHub Enterprise Server 310 Docs, перейдите в раздел “Настройки” и выберите “Роли и разрешения”. Здесь вы можете просмотреть текущие роли и разрешения, добавлять новых пользователей и команды, а также настраивать их права. Кроме того, вы можете установить уровень доступа к репозиториям и организациям для каждой роли.
Управление доступом к программным продуктам с помощью GitHub Enterprise Server 310 Docs позволяет оптимизировать работу команды, улучшить безопасность и повысить производительность. Правильная настройка ролей и разрешений поможет сократить риски, связанные с несанкционированным доступом и модификацией кода.
Настройка ограничений доступа
В GitHub Enterprise Server 310 Docs предоставляется возможность настраивать ограничения доступа к программным продуктам в организации. Это позволяет ограничить доступ к репозиториям и управлять правами пользователей и команд.
Для начала настройки ограничений доступа необходимо перейти в раздел “Настройки” в меню GitHub Enterprise Server 310 Docs. Затем выберите “Управление доступом” и перейдите к разделу “Ограничения доступа”.
В этом разделе вы можете создавать и удалять ограничения доступа для пользователей и команд. Для создания нового ограничения доступа щелкните на кнопку “Создать ограничение доступа”. В появившемся окне выберите субъект, к которому вы хотите применить ограничение (пользователь или команда), а затем выберите действие, которое вы хотите ограничить (чтение, запись или администрирование).
После выбора субъекта и действия вы можете определить область применения ограничения. Например, вы можете указать репозиторий или группу репозиториев, к которым будет применяться ограничение. Вы также можете ограничить доступ к определенным веткам или файлам.
После настройки области применения ограничения вы можете указать, кому будет применяться ограничение. Вы можете выбрать определенного пользователя или команду, или же определить ограничения для всех пользователей или команд в организации.
После создания ограничения доступа оно начинает действовать немедленно. Пользователи, которые пытаются выполнить действие, ограниченное ограничением доступа, будут получать сообщение об ошибке.
Кроме создания ограничений доступа, вы также можете просматривать и удалять уже существующие ограничения в разделе “Ограничения доступа”. Вы также можете отключить или включить ограничения при необходимости.
Настройка ограничений доступа позволяет эффективно управлять доступом к программным продуктам в организации и обеспечивать безопасность данных. С помощью GitHub Enterprise Server 310 Docs вы можете легко настроить ограничения, чтобы обеспечить доступ только авторизованным пользователям и командам.
Пользователь | Доступ |
---|---|
Иванов Иван | Администрирование |
Петров Петр | Чтение |
Сидоров Сидор | Запись |
Назначение ролей пользователям
В GitHub Enterprise Server 310 Docs предусмотрена система назначения ролей пользователям для управления доступом к программным продуктам в организации. Каждая роль предоставляет определенные привилегии и ограничения, которые определяются администратором системы.
В таблице ниже приведены основные роли пользователей в GitHub Enterprise Server 310 Docs:
Роль | Описание |
---|---|
Администратор | Полные права доступа и администрирования системы. Может добавлять и удалять пользователей, назначать роли, изменять настройки безопасности и т.д. |
Менеджер | Права доступа к настройкам и управлению репозиториями. Может назначать и удалять пользователей, изменять разрешения на доступ, управлять версиями программных продуктов и т.д. |
Разработчик | Ограниченные права доступа к репозиториям и разработке программных продуктов. Может загружать и обновлять код, создавать и удалять ветки, участвовать в обсуждениях и т.д. |
Пользователь | Базовые права доступа к программным продуктам. Может просматривать код, открывать задачи и вносить комментарии, участвовать в общении и т.д. |
Важно знать, что уровень доступа каждой роли может быть настроен индивидуально в соответствии с требованиями организации. Назначение ролей пользователю осуществляется администратором системы, который может управлять этим процессом с помощью соответствующих инструментов в GitHub Enterprise Server 310 Docs.
Назначение ролей пользователю позволяет эффективно организовать работу внутри организации, обеспечивает безопасность данных и эффективное управление программными продуктами.
Установка разрешений для ролей
GitHub Enterprise Server позволяет управлять доступом к программным продуктам в организации с помощью назначения разрешений для различных ролей пользователей. Это помогает организации эффективно управлять правами доступа ко всему программному обеспечению и контролировать, кто имеет доступ к каким данным.
Для установки разрешений для ролей в GitHub Enterprise Server выполните следующие шаги:
- Откройте веб-интерфейс GitHub Enterprise Server и перейдите в настройки организации.
- Выберите раздел “Роли и разрешения” в меню настроек.
- Нажмите на кнопку “Добавить роль”, чтобы создать новую роль.
- Введите название роли и описание, чтобы легко идентифицировать и описать ее назначение.
- Выберите разрешения, которые вы хотите предоставить пользователям с данной ролью. Вы можете установить разрешения для доступа к конкретным репозиториям, возможностям управления пользователями или другим функциям GitHub.
- Нажмите на кнопку “Сохранить”, чтобы сохранить роль.
После установки разрешений для ролей, вы можете назначать и удалять пользователей для каждой роли в организации. Это позволяет эффективно управлять доступом к программным продуктам в вашей организации и обеспечить безопасность данных.
Помните, что установка разрешений для ролей является важной частью управления доступом к программным продуктам в организации. Обязательно регулярно анализируйте и обновляйте разрешения, чтобы отражать текущие потребности организации и предотвращать несанкционированный доступ к данным.
Раздел 2: Управление группами пользователей
Для эффективного управления доступом к программным продуктам в организации необходимо уметь группировать пользователей по их ролям и обязанностям. GitHub Enterprise Server предоставляет возможность создания и управления группами пользователей, что упрощает процесс назначения прав доступа.
Создание новой группы пользователей осуществляется с помощью встроенного инструмента управления GitHub Enterprise Server. После создания группы можно назначить ей ряд пользователей, а также определить ее права доступа к конкретным программным продуктам.
Название группы | Пользователи | Права доступа |
---|---|---|
Администраторы | Иванов Иван, Петров Петр, Сидоров Сидор | Полный доступ ко всем программным продуктам |
Разработчики | Смирнов Алексей, Козлов Дмитрий, Волков Андрей | Доступ к репозиториям для разработки и тестирования |
Тестировщики | Николаев Александр, Морозов Денис, Зайцев Игорь | Доступ только для тестирования и отслеживания ошибок |
После создания группы пользователей и назначения им прав доступа, управление этими группами становится гораздо более удобным. Администраторы организации могут быстро и легко изменять состав групп, назначать и снимать права доступа в зависимости от потребностей процесса разработки.
Создание и управление группами
GitHub Enterprise Server позволяет создавать и управлять группами пользователей в организации. Группы помогают упростить управление доступом к программным продуктам и ресурсам.
Чтобы создать новую группу, нужно выполнить следующие шаги:
- Откройте страницу “Группы” в настройках организации.
- Нажмите кнопку “Создать группу”.
- Введите имя группы и описание (опционально).
- Выберите пользователей, которых хотите добавить в группу.
- Нажмите “Создать группу” для создания новой группы.
После создания группы, вы можете управлять ее настройками и участниками:
- Изменить имя и описание группы.
- Добавить или удалить пользователей из группы.
- Управлять уровнем доступа для каждого участника группы.
- Назначить роли группы, которые определяют, какие действия могут выполнять ее участники.
Группы позволяют эффективно организовывать управление доступом к программным продуктам в организации. Они упрощают процесс назначения и отзыва прав доступа, а также позволяют управлять доступом к различным ресурсам внутри организации.
Использование групп позволяет сократить количество работы, связанной с управлением доступом для каждого пользователя отдельно. Это помогает повысить безопасность и увеличить эффективность процессов управления доступом в организации.
Примечание: Группы в GitHub Enterprise Server используются для управления доступом к программным продуктам и ресурсам внутри организации. Они не влияют на доступ к репозиториям публичного или закрытого типа.
Присвоение прав доступа группам
В GitHub Enterprise Server 310 Docs доступ к программным продуктам в организации можно управлять с помощью групп пользователей. Группы позволяют упростить назначение и изменение прав доступа, а также обеспечить единообразие настроек.
Чтобы присвоить права доступа группам, необходимо выполнить следующие шаги:
- Авторизоваться в административной панели GitHub Enterprise Server.
- Перейти в раздел “Организации” и выбрать нужную организацию.
- Перейти в раздел “Группы” и выбрать нужную группу.
- На странице группы выбрать вкладку “Права доступа”.
- Нажать на кнопку “Добавить право доступа” и выбрать нужную роль.
- Выбрать одно или несколько хранилищ, к которым будет применено право доступа.
- Нажать на кнопку “Сохранить” для применения изменений.
После присвоения прав доступа группе, участники этой группы будут иметь возможность работать с выбранными хранилищами согласно назначенной роли. Права доступа можно изменять или удалить в любой момент.
Присваивание прав доступа группам позволяет эффективно управлять доступом к программным продуктам в организации, обеспечивая безопасность и контроль над ресурсами.
Группа | Роль | Хранилище |
---|---|---|
Администраторы | Администратор | Хранилище 1 |
Разработчики | Разработчик | Хранилище 2 |
Тестировщики | Чтение/Запись | Хранилище 3 |
В таблице приведен пример разделения прав доступа на уровне групп. Группа “Администраторы” имеет роль “Администратор” и полный доступ к хранилищу 1. Группа “Разработчики” имеет роль “Разработчик” и доступ к хранилищу 2. Группа “Тестировщики” имеет роль “Чтение/Запись” и доступ к хранилищу 3.
Использование групп для присвоения прав доступа облегчает администрирование и повышает безопасность системы управления программными продуктами в организации.
Добавление и удаление пользователей из группы
Для эффективного управления доступом к программным продуктам в организации с помощью GitHub Enterprise Server 310 Docs, предусмотрена возможность добавления и удаления пользователей из группы. Это позволяет управлять правами доступа для конкретных групп сотрудников и контролировать их работу.
Для добавления пользователя в группу необходимо выполнить следующие шаги:
- Перейдите на страницу управления группами в GitHub Enterprise Server 310 Docs.
- Выберите нужную группу, в которую хотите добавить пользователя.
- Нажмите на кнопку “Добавить пользователя” или аналогичный элемент управления.
- Введите имя пользователя или его адрес электронной почты в соответствующее поле.
- Нажмите на кнопку “Добавить” или аналогичный элемент управления для подтверждения действия.
Для удаления пользователя из группы следуйте указанным ниже инструкциям:
- Перейдите на страницу управления группами в GitHub Enterprise Server 310 Docs.
- Выберите нужную группу, из которой хотите удалить пользователя.
- Найдите пользователя в списке пользователей группы и выберите его.
- Нажмите на кнопку “Удалить пользователя” или аналогичный элемент управления.
- Подтвердите удаление пользователя, нажав на кнопку “Удалить” или аналогичный элемент управления.
После выполнения указанных шагов, пользователь будет добавлен или удален из группы, в зависимости от выбранного действия. Данный функционал позволяет быстро и удобно управлять доступом к программным продуктам в организации с помощью GitHub Enterprise Server 310 Docs.
Вопрос-ответ:
Что такое GitHub Enterprise Server 310 Docs?
GitHub Enterprise Server 310 Docs – это документация, которая предоставляет инструкции и руководства по использованию GitHub Enterprise Server для управления доступом к программным продуктам в организации. Она помогает организациям настраивать и контролировать доступ к своим программным проектам, а также управлять правами и ролями пользователей.
Каким образом GitHub Enterprise Server помогает в управлении доступом к программным продуктам?
GitHub Enterprise Server предоставляет различные инструменты и функции для настройки и контроля доступа к программным продуктам. Он позволяет создавать организации, устанавливать права доступа для пользователей и групп, настраивать механизм аутентификации, а также контролировать и аудитировать изменения в репозиториях и проектах.
Как можно установить GitHub Enterprise Server для управления доступом?
Установка GitHub Enterprise Server состоит из нескольких шагов: подготовка сервера, загрузка и запуск установщика, настройка параметров системы и аутентификации, а затем выполнение инициализации сервера. Подробные инструкции по установке можно найти в документации GitHub Enterprise Server 310 Docs.
Какие существуют роли и разрешения в GitHub Enterprise Server?
В GitHub Enterprise Server существуют различные роли и разрешения, которые могут быть назначены пользователям. Некоторые из ролей включают владельца организации, администратора, коллаборатора и гостя. Разрешения могут быть установлены для доступа к репозиториям, веткам, задачам и другим функциям системы.
Как осуществляется аудит изменений в GitHub Enterprise Server?
GitHub Enterprise Server содержит функции аудита, которые позволяют отслеживать и регистрировать изменения в репозиториях и проектах. Система ведет журнал, который содержит информацию о действиях пользователей, времени, IP-адресах и других метаданных. Это обеспечивает прозрачность и контроль над изменениями в системе.
Что такое GitHub Enterprise Server 310 Docs?
GitHub Enterprise Server 310 Docs – это документация, которая объясняет, как управлять доступом к программным продуктам в организации с использованием GitHub Enterprise Server версии 3.10.
Какие функции предоставляет GitHub Enterprise Server 310 Docs?
GitHub Enterprise Server 310 Docs предоставляет функции для управления доступом к программным продуктам в организации. Он позволяет определять права доступа для разных пользователей или групп пользователей, устанавливать политики безопасности, отслеживать изменения и многое другое.
Видео:
Git – как совместно вести разработку одного проекта. Полезно знать новичкам в программировании.
Git – как совместно вести разработку одного проекта. Полезно знать новичкам в программировании. by Vitaly Liber 19,079 views 2 years ago 9 minutes, 47 seconds